> I'm having problems creating voice files in Cygwin with a Finnish
> SAPI 5
> synthesizer. I've tried this on two different XP machines and got
> exactly the same results. The process suddenly stops and I get the
> following error message:
>
> Error -2147200966:
> Use of uninitialized value in substitution (s///) at
> /home/Jani/rockbox/tools/voice.pl line 97.
> Generating voice clipsmake: *** [voice] Error 141
>
> Does anybody know what that means? Is the voice.pl script causing this
> problem, or can it be something else? Could someone please take a look
> at the script and see if the problem can be fixed?

What synthesizer are you using? I don't know what is causing that kind of
problem, but I believe that the problem is in the sapi5 synth. Try to build
an english.voice file with for example Microsoft sam and test if it works.
If not, something might be wrong in your build environment.
